When the Grid Goes Silent: How a 2000W Inverter Steps In

Power outages are unpredictable and often inconvenient, especially when they strike during critical moments. Whether you're at home, on the road, or deep in the wilderness, a 2000W inverter acts as a dependable energy bridge. It converts direct current (DC) from batteries or solar panels into alternating current (AC), the kind of electricity most household appliances and tools require. This makes it an indispensable asset for maintaining productivity, comfort, and safety in off-grid or emergency situations.

Understanding What Makes 2000W Special

Wattage is more than just a number — it's the measure of an inverter’s ability to power your devices. With a 2000W capacity, this inverter can effortlessly handle a wide range of appliances, from essential home devices like refrigerators and microwaves to power tools like drills and saws. It even supports small air conditioning units or coffee makers during your outdoor adventures.

But power alone isn’t enough. The type of waveform your inverter produces matters too. Pure sine wave inverters, like our 2000W model, deliver clean and stable electricity — the same quality as your wall outlet — making them safe for sensitive electronics such as laptops, chargers, and medical devices.

How to Choose the Right Battery for Your 2000W Inverter

To get the most out of your 2000W inverter, pairing it with the right battery is essential. The battery’s voltage (typically 12V or 24V) and its capacity (measured in ampere-hours or Ah) determine how long your inverter can run your devices before needing a recharge. A 12V 100Ah battery, for example, could power a 1000W load for about an hour — so with a 2000W draw, that time would be reduced accordingly.

For optimal performance, consider using deep-cycle batteries like AGM, gel, or lithium-ion types, which are designed for repeated discharge and recharge cycles. Lithium batteries, while more expensive, offer longer life, lighter weight, and faster recharge times, making them especially popular for mobile and outdoor applications.

Maximizing the Lifespan and Efficiency of Your Inverter

Proper installation and maintenance can significantly extend the life of your inverter and ensure it performs at its best. Always mount it in a cool, dry location with adequate ventilation to prevent overheating. Avoid overloading the system by calculating your total wattage before plugging in multiple devices. And remember to check connections regularly to ensure they remain tight and corrosion-free.

Many modern inverters come with built-in protections against overloads, short circuits, and overheating — features that can prevent damage and costly repairs. Taking the time to understand and respect your inverter’s limits will pay off in long-term reliability and performance.

Beyond Power: What Else to Look for in a 2000W Inverter

When selecting a 2000W inverter, don’t just focus on power output. Consider additional features that enhance usability and safety. Look for models with comprehensive protection systems, including safeguards against overvoltage, undervoltage, and overheating. Quiet operation is also a plus, especially if you plan to use the inverter indoors or in a camping environment.

Modern inverters often include multiple USB ports, fast charging capabilities, and remote control options — all designed to make your life easier. Some even feature energy-saving modes that reduce power consumption when devices aren’t in use, helping you get more from every charge.
